 This doTerra proprietary blend - the name stands for Daily DNA Repair is a mix of essential oils that help protect the body against oxidative stress to cellular DNA.* and so supports cellular integrity.  Clove, Thyme, Litsea, and Wild Orange are powerful antioxidants and it also includes Frankincense, Lemongrass, Summer Savory, and Niaouli, which help support a healthy immune response.




Cells are the foundation of all living things. Their growth, replication, and death provide the information for the function of all our body’s systems. As we age, cellular function progressively degrades and this process can be expedited by poor nutrition, lack of exercise, stress, exposure to toxins, and other lifestyle habits. When cellular function is compromised, the normal process of growth and regeneration is altered, negatively impacting all normal and healthy processes.

Antioxidants are key to a healthy body as inflammation is the body's process of fighting against things that harm it, like infections, injuries, and toxins, in an attempt to heal itself. When something damages your cells, your body releases chemicals that trigger a response from your immune system.  Now we often need the inflammatory process to promote healing like with a cut or a break and this response includes the release of antibodies and proteins, as well as increased blood flow to the damaged area. In the case of acute inflammation — like getting a cut on your knee or dealing with a cold — the whole process usually lasts for a few hours or a few days of pain, redness, or swelling.

Now you may have heard of free radicals and wondered what they are these - these are infact an atom with an unpaired electron, and these little things cause inflammation in us and out pets by cellular damage. Chronic inflammation produces lots of free radicals which ultimately create more inflammation. This continuous vicious cycle can damage many systems in the human body.  Antioxidants neutralise the free radicals by giving up some of their own electrons - I liken it to a game of Pac Mac with Pac Man scooping up the little dots.  

Eating foods and taking supplements rich in antioxidants can help that significantly.  


Antioxidants are also crucial for brain health -brain dervied neurotrophic factor  (BDNF) is key for neuroplasticity which is the capacity of neurons and neural networks in the brain to change their connections and behaviour in response to new information,  This is crucial for maintaining brain health as we age but also supporting mental health and also key for recovery from stroke and also supporting the brain with those who have dementia.  

What boosts BDNF is an antioxidant rich diet! So it stands to reason that by adding a blend that provides antioxidants rich oils we can give our diet a little boost.
